It really is all in with the White Sox this season. When the team's hitting, the entire lineup is hitting. The opposite has held true during their recent offensive drought. Last night's 9-2 whipping of the Tampa Bay Rays at Tropicana Field saw contributions throughout the lineup and the Sox hitting a respectable 6-for-17 with runners in scoring position. Paul Konerko, Carlos Quentin, AJ Pierzynski and Omar Vizquel each drove in two runs, providing more than enough run support for Gavin Floyd to earn his second win of the season. More good news - the 1-0 first inning lead ended a stretch of 51 innings where they trailed the opposition. Hopefully for Sox fans the bats woke up at the right time, as they travel to Detroit for a weekend series with Tigers. Mark Buehrle takes on Justin Verlander in a pitcher's duel at 6:05 p.m.
